Oil Catch Cleaning: Essential Maintenance for Your Service
For numerous commercial cooking areas and food service facilities, oil traps play a vital role in keeping correct cleanliness and protecting against pipes problems. These devices are made to capture fat, oil, and oil (HAZE) before they can go into the wastewater system. Nonetheless, just like any type of various other element of your cooking area, grease catches call for routine upkeep and cleansing to operate properly. In this article, we’ll look into the importance of grease trap cleansing and provide vital insights on just how to bring it out correctly.
Normal oil catch cleansing is important for numerous reasons. Firstly, an unmaintained oil catch can cause serious blockages in your pipes system, leading to expensive repair services and downtime for your business. With time, grease can build up and harden, making it testing to eliminate. Furthermore, health and wellness evaluations can be rigid relating to the problem of oil catches. Failing to maintain them clean can result in fines and even closure if your facility is located in infraction of local health guidelines. For that reason, preserving a tidy grease catch is not just valuable for your plumbing however likewise critical for adhering to health and wellness codes.
The cleansing procedure for a grease trap is fairly uncomplicated but needs proper devices and safety and security precautions. The primary step is to pull the lid off the grease catch. It is very important to use gloves and protective eyeglasses, as the components can be hazardous. Utilizing an inside story or a pump, eliminate the built up oil and food particles. This mixture is often called “oil sludge,” and it must be disposed of at an assigned waste center to avoid environmental injury. After removing the bulk of the material, the catch needs to be rinsed with hot water, and any remaining debris ought to be scuffed or brushed away.
To stay clear of frustrating your oil trap with FOG, it’s a good idea to apply pre-treatment measures. These can include straining food waste before disposal or utilizing emulsifiers that help damage down fats and oils. Furthermore, scheduling routine oil trap cleansings– generally each to three months depending upon your cooking area’s volume– will make sure ideal functionality. Partnering with a specialist grease trap cleaning service can also simplify the process, as they have the know-how and equipment required to execute comprehensive cleanings and assessments.
